About 2-heptyl-5-hex-5-enylpyrrolidine
2-heptyl-5-hex-5-enylpyrrolidine (PubChem CID 592536) has the molecular formula C17H33N
and a molecular weight of 251.46 g/mol. Its IUPAC name is 2-heptyl-5-hex-5-enylpyrrolidine.
